Output c20ecf6a32cde5c29fd32cb5e9eec88aca5c927d03580ce3ab47dcb62b157078:3

value
488569528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 479ee2e18bf303c4c30aa94953be4da17ed773f8 OP_EQUAL
address
38DiEmrcBrU1y5MkeqPcCRh2AV5atS3Zu1
transaction
c20ecf6a32cde5c29fd32cb5e9eec88aca5c927d03580ce3ab47dcb62b157078
confirmations
330149
spent
true